How does activated charcoal work for decontamination and how should it be administered? 
High surface area binding to toxin and preventing systemic absorption. Dose: 10:1 (10g AC per 1g drug) 
 
 
When is activated charcoal contraindicated or ineffective? 
Contraindicated in AMS/obtunded patient, risk of seizure or aspiration, ileus. Ineffective for pesticides, lithium, hydrocarbons, heavy metals, alcohols, caustics.
